In cosmetics, honey works as a humectant. That is what it does: it holds water in the fibre, and the softness and shine come from there.
01 · WHAT THE HONEY DOES HERE
Honey is hygroscopic: it attracts and holds moisture, and applied to damp hair that is what leaves the fibre more supple and brighter. The rest of the formula backs it up: argan and coconut bring the oils, the wheat proteins bring body, and the cider vinegar closes the cuticle.

03 · HOW TO USE IT
On damp, towel-dried hair, work a small amount through the mid-lengths and ends, keeping off the roots, and leave it a few minutes. Rinse with cold water: it leaves the cuticle flatter and the shine shows more.
